About Greentown, OH
Greentown is a city in Ohio, located in Stark County. The city spans 1 ZIP code and is home to approximately 180 residents. It is a middle-aged city, with a median age of 44 years.
The population of Greentown is highly educated. 66.9%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her — significantly above the national average. The community is primarily White (100%).
